Chloe Arensberg Biography and Wiki
Chloe Arensberg is the Washington based senior producer for CBS This Morning, overseeing coverage of The White House, Congress, and all government agencies as well as breaking news beyond the beltway. Previously, Chloe worked as Asia Bureau Chief for CBS News. While based in China, she directed the division’s coverage of the region and managed both the Beijing and Tokyo bureaus of CBS News.

Chloe Arensberg Education
Chloe acquired a bachelor’s degree from Barnard College, Columbia University, and a master’s degree from Harvard University’s Kennedy School of Government.

Chloe Arensberg CBS News
Chloe oversaw CBS News on the ground coverage of the Helsinki and Singapore Summits of 2018. She has produced interviews with Vice President Mike Pence, President Obama, Vice President Joe Biden, and Secretary of State Hillary Clinton.
Chloe has received two Emmy nominations, and her contribution to CBS News team coverage of the 2012 Newton tragedy earned her a 2012 – 2013 Alfred I. DuPont Columbia University Award. Since joining CBS News in 2002, Chloe has distinguished herself as a top producer at the network and a key part of the news team.
She has covered major international and global news events such as the 2015 earthquake in Nepal; the Hong Kong protests in 2014; the regional disputes in the South China Sea; 2004, 2008 and 2012 Presidential campaigns, and the 2010 earthquake in Haiti and Hurrican Katrina. During her time in Asia, she represented CBS News on two trips to North Korea.
As the White Producer for the CBS Evening News, Chloe traveled with President Barack Obama to 24 countries across six continents. She reported on congressional battles over health care, gun control, and government funding.
She also covered major global policy matters such as the conflicts in Libya, Syria, Ukraine, the Iran nuclear deal, the North Korean nuclear program, and the debate over NSA surveillance. CBS News Channel
CBS Evening News is the flagship evening TV news program of CBS News, the news division of the CBS TV network in the United States. The CBS Evening News is a daily broadcast featuring news reports, feature stories, and interviews by CBS News journalists and reporters covering events across the world. The program has been broadcast since July 1st, 1941 under the original title CBS TV News, eventually adopting its current title in 1963.
